Output dd4a2e6c8a2a72a28f7ecb91caacebf8dd40edcebf0dc2699f895c8ff0d1588e:1

value
890915213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f29f51fecc0d22fc8c1826e6cf4ca6353c091858 OP_EQUAL
address
3PotJjaBb1YKYgDpPjjkY8MscnqJcTwquD
transaction
dd4a2e6c8a2a72a28f7ecb91caacebf8dd40edcebf0dc2699f895c8ff0d1588e
confirmations
302252
spent
true